2001 E320 AWD Wagon needs a part

So far on two forums no one has an answer for this part, what it is called or a part number. The reason I can surmize so far is that no one needs it here in North America. I think it's an evap valve of some sort and perhaps this is the part number but again you'll all see that there is no picture associated with it and anywhere you find it for sale, they'll describe it as 'valve' with a price tag of 400 or more. Hardly enough to bring confidence to a purchase right?

It connects to the gas filler neck and to the charcoal canister. I've replaced the purge valve under the hood, the plunger valve on the canister and since doing that I now have a P0446 code and at the same time I cannot fill the car with anymore than 3/4 tank as the car now chokes, it's happened instantly after those parts were changed out. This part when I blow on that hose, is plugged or shut and explains why I didn't have issue's filling the tank before as the plunger valve was stuck open and I was getting a P0455 code (mass leak)

Ok so I'm left with no other option but to pull it, open it and try to repair it. Which means for me, I'll have to put everything back together unfixed as I haven't enough worm clamps should the process go bad, go back into town, get more hoses and clamps and then sit down for destruction.

If anyone has any info on the mystery part that no one else has in their car (I stayed up until 2am searching and could not find one instance of anything outside of a purge valve/plunger valve as part of the emissions system) I need a part number for this thing so I'm assured of what it is and then I can make a decision to buy new or repair this one or at least try. Bro.,

As i know; there are two types of Evap. check valves, that only comes with "U.S/Aus" versions:-

A) "000 997 58 87", code # "003/494/F"

B) "210 476 06 32", code # "004/494"

*these two Evap. check valves not show up on "Euro/Gulf/Japanese" versions..

Hi Zayed! Confirmed. Part number 210 476 06 32

I just pulled it and have blown through all the ports. I can hear the diaphragm moving in the part and the port by my little finger will allow a little air if I suck really hard on it. I think this part is working ok but was stuck.
When I blow on any other port very gently the air will come out the other ports (not the one by my little finger) If I blow on any of the ports very hard, the diaphragm kicks in and allows the air only to route through the port by my little finger. So I think that diaphragm in the middle needs a little cleaning but I don't know what best to clean with? Soak the interior in WD 40? I'm looking at the part it seems like it's all self enclosed, I don't think those star heads will come off so I can take that bracket off.

I'll start another thread and ask others what they think.



The port by my little finger won't let air in but will let me suck air out.

Fixed! Fixed oh sweet begebus my car is finally check engine light free with ZERO codes on my OBD scanner. I took MAS airflow and sprayed every port on this until it was running out like water, did a little sucking and blowing and reinstalled it. All good and so is the beer!
